Functions of a Warehouse Management System

The functions of a warehouse management system go beyond simple storage — they include inventory tracking, real-time data reporting, and automation of warehouse tasks. Learners will explore how such systems enhance visibility, accuracy, and responsiveness across supply chains. The module covers topics such as receiving, picking, packaging, and dispatching, showing how technology supports these core functions to achieve operational excellence.

FAQs

1. What are the main warehouse management functions?
The main warehouse management functions include storage, inventory control, order fulfilment, and goods dispatching to ensure smooth operations.

2. What are the functions of a warehouse management system?
The functions of a warehouse management system involve automating storage, tracking inventory, managing orders, and improving workflow accuracy.

3. How do warehouse management functions improve efficiency?
They streamline operations, reduce manual errors, and optimise the use of space, technology, and labour for cost-effective warehousing.

4. Why is it important to understand warehouse management functions?
Understanding warehouse management functions helps professionals manage logistics effectively, reduce costs, and deliver customer satisfaction.

5. How does technology enhance the functions of a warehouse management system?
Technology enables real-time tracking, automation, and analytics, improving speed, accuracy, and overall warehouse performance.
